Exploring Computer Architecture: The Core of Computation

A fundamental concept in the realm of computing, computer system architecture provides a structured framework for understanding how hardware and software components work together within a digital device. This blueprint defines the design of key elements such as the processor, memory, input/output devices, and their interconnections.

By delineating these components and their interactions, computer system architecture enables developers to build efficient and reliable software applications that can harness the full potential of the underlying hardware. A deep understanding of architecture is critical for optimizing performance, enhancing resource utilization, and ensuring seamless operation across a variety of computing platforms.
